The Jacksonville rapper, whose real name was Janarious Mykel Wheeler, was reportedly declared dead at 11:23 a.m. ET on Wednesday, as stated by the Fulton County Medical Examiner’s Office, according to journalists. The cause of his death has not yet been disclosed.
The CMG artist, born Janarious Mykel Wheeler, was said to have passed away on Wednesday.
Rapper Lil Poppa performed during Rod Wave’s Last Lap Tour at the State Farm Arena in Atlanta, Georgia, on December 5, 2024.
As per his Ticketmaster page, Poppa was set to perform at the Fillmore in New Orleans on March 21. His latest single, “Out of Town Bae,” was released on February 13.
In 2022, Lil Poppa signed with Yo Gotti’s Collective Music Group (CMG) following the success of his mixtape series, Under Investigation.
The most recent installment, Under Investigation 3, came out in 2022.
In recent years, Lil Poppa released several albums, including Almost Normal Again in 2025. This LP featured singles like “Bout My Respect” and “Myself Again,” along with collaborations with artists such as Yungeen Ace and Mozzy.
After the album’s release, Poppa went on a twenty-date tour called the Almost Normal Again Tour and previously joined Rod Wave on the Last Lap Tour, with whom he collaborated on the song “Falling Fast.”
